The freshly acquired $200 million estate in Malibu, California, is owned by Jay-Z and Beyoncé. The 30,000-square-foot compound is situated in what is referred to be “billionaire’s row”. $177 million was the previous high-end home sale record in California.

Beyoncé and JAY-Z just took possession of a 30,000-square-foot estate in the posh neighborhood of Malibu, California. The power couple broke the record for the most expensive home ever bought in the state when they paid USD 200 million for the mansion in Malibu. The Knowles-Carters appear to have gotten a terrific deal on the home. As it was once advertised for USD 295 million, according to TMZ.

The building is a minimalist masterpiece and architectural marvel that Tadao Ando created

The mansion, which was once owned and constructed by well-known art collector William Bell, is one of the few American residences designed by the Japanese master architect. Who is presently working on Kanye West’s home in Malibu.

The new Malibu residence of JAY-Z and Beyoncé is a record-breaker, but it isn’t the priciest residential real estate transaction in the nation. The four-story penthouse in NYC that Ken Griffin paid USD 238 million for back in 2019 still holds the record.

Bill and Maria Bell, great collectors of modern art were the ones who initially ordered Beyoncé’s new home. Its construction took 15 years, and 7,645 cubic yards of concrete were needed for the home alone. Additionally, the pair once let artist Alex Israel use their house for a post-apocalyptic photo shoot. Featuring a chimpanzee named Eli.

Although it is the largest detached home real estate transaction in the nation. This wasn’t the most costly house ever sold. The condo in New York City that set this record was purchased for $238 million in 2019 by hedge fund billionaire Ken Griffin. However, it’s possible that “apartment” undersells the property a little. The penthouse apartment at the top of the 220 Central Park building has four complete levels.
